Understanding Pet Insurance With Direct Vet Payments

Pet insurance is an essential consideration for pet owners, providing financial support for unexpected veterinary expenses. One innovative approach is direct vet pay, a system where insurers pay veterinarians directly. This eliminates the out-of-pocket burden typically placed on pet owners, offering significant relief, especially for large vet bills that can be financially challenging. The convenience of direct vet pay lies in its process, whereby after a pet receives treatment, the veterinarian submits the bill to the insurer for approval, relieving the owner from managing hefty upfront payments.

Leading pet insurance providers offering direct payments include Trupanion and Pets Best. These companies require participating veterinarians to be within their network to accept direct insurances payments. Many pet owners find this method advantageous as it reduces financial strain and facilitates adherence to recommended health plans for their pets.

Benefits of Direct Vet Pay

The primary advantage of direct vet pay is the financial relief it provides pet owners. Often faced with demanding veterinary costs, being able to bypass initial payment hurdles ensures timely and appropriate care for pets. Furthermore, it allows pet owners to fully focus on the well-being of their pets without the distraction of financial concerns. The peace of mind offered by knowing the insurance policy will handle large expense claims is particularly beneficial to those without emergency funds set aside.

Additional benefits include the simplification of the claims process. The insurer directly communicating with the veterinarian bypasses much of the traditional paperwork that pet owners typically handle. Although the direct pay method may still necessitate submitting a claim form or release document, this is a minor step compared to the standard method of reimbursement submission.

Considerations and Potential Drawbacks

Despite the benefits, there are considerations and potential drawbacks to direct vet pay. One significant limitation can be the network of participating veterinarians. Not all veterinary practices may accept direct payments, limiting options for pet owners. Furthermore, it necessitates prior coordination between the veterinarian and the insurance company to ensure alignment before treatment since not all practices may be in-network or agree to insurer terms.

There are also instances where insurers cover only a portion of the claim, meaning the owner remains responsible for any deductible, co-insurance, or exclusions. It’s essential for pet owners to understand the specific limits and conditions of their insurance policy fully. Evaluating the coverage details and ensuring the preferred veterinarian participates in the direct payment program is crucial in avoiding unforeseen expenses.

Tips for Choosing the Right Insurance Plan

When selecting pet insurance with a direct payment option, several factors need consideration. Evaluating coverage for various services, deductibles, reimbursement rates, and limits will contribute to making an informed decision. It’s important to compare the details of different policies and their direct pay conditions. Moreover, understanding company ratings and customer feedback can provide insights into the reliability and efficiency of insurers offering direct payment plans. Ensure comprehensive evaluation of policy terms, including any stipulations around preventive care or emergency visit coverage. Don’t overlook the significance of reviewing the waiting periods for specific claims processing, as these can affect how soon benefits become available.

By analyzing these elements, pet owners can secure a suitable insurance solution that aligns with both their financial capabilities and their pet’s medical needs.
